CNN anchor Don Lemon reveals in his new memoir, "Transparent," that he is gay.

"I think it would be great if everybody could be out," he said in an interview yesterday with The New York Times. "But it's such a personal choice. People have to do it at their own speed. I respect that. I do have to say that the more people who come out, the better it is for everyone, certainly for the Tyler Clementis of the world."

Clementi was the Rutgers University student who jumped off the George Washington Bridge after a sexual encounter with another male in his dorm room was allegedly taped by his roommate, who has been indicted in the case, and broadcast online.

"I think if I had seen more people like me who are out and proud, it wouldn't have taken me 45 years to say it, to walk in the truth," Lemon said.
